SAN JOSÉ, Calif. – The University of Texas Rio Grande Valley (UTRGV) men's soccer team clinched its first-ever berth in the Western Athletic Conference (WAC) Tournament with a 2-1 victory over San José State University (SJSU) on Saturday at Spartan Soccer Field.
UTRGV (6-8-3, 4-4-2 WAC) will be the No. 5 seed and face No. 4 seed UNLV in the WAC Tournament Quarterfinals on Thursday at 7 p.m. at Utah Valley. UTRGV beat UNLV 1-0 at home on Oct. 6. The winner of this match will face top-seeded and 15
th-ranked Utah Valley on Friday at 7 p.m. in the WAC Tournament Semifinals.
SJSU (4-13-2, 3-6-1 WAC) took a 1-0 lead on a
Carlos Valdovinos goal at 62:18, but 59 seconds later, freshman
Ilias Kosmidis scored on a bicycle kick to tie the match. It was hit second goal of the season. Freshman
Damian Roszczyk got his third assist on the play.
UTRGV got the game-winner in the 85
th minute when senior
Sami Tiittanen sent a long ball ahead to sophomore
Isaiah Hinds, who broke past the SJSU defense to score his first goal of the season.
Freshman
Esa Aalto (5-4-2) made a career-high tying seven saves, including five in the second half.
Nedin Tucakovic (4-13-2) made one save for SJSU.
